"""HTTP client utilities for making requests to the backend API""" import aiohttp from typing import Optional import ssl import os def get_windows_host_ip() -> Optional[str]: """ Get the Windows host IP address when running in WSL. In WSL2, the Windows host IP is typically the first nameserver in /etc/resolv.conf. """ try: if os.path.exists("/etc/resolv.conf"): with open("/etc/resolv.conf", "r") as f: for line in f: if line.startswith("nameserver"): ip = line.split()[1] if ip not in ["127.0.0.1", "127.0.0.53"] and not ip.startswith("fe80"): return ip except Exception: pass return None def normalize_backend_url(url: str) -> str: """ Normalize backend URL for better compatibility, especially on WSL and Docker. """ if not ("localhost" in url or "127.0.0.1" in url): return url if os.path.exists("/.dockerenv"): print(f"Warning: Running in Docker but URL contains localhost: {url}") print("Please set BACKEND_URL environment variable in docker-compose.yml to use Docker service name (e.g., http://backend:8000/api/v1)") return url.replace("localhost", "127.0.0.1") try: if os.path.exists("/proc/version"): with open("/proc/version", "r") as f: version_content = f.read().lower() if "microsoft" in version_content: windows_ip = get_windows_host_ip() if windows_ip: if "localhost" in url or "127.0.0.1" in url: url = url.replace("localhost", windows_ip).replace("127.0.0.1", windows_ip) print(f"WSL detected: Using Windows host IP {windows_ip} for backend connection") return url except Exception as e: print(f"Warning: Could not detect WSL environment: {e}") if url.startswith("http://localhost") or url.startswith("https://localhost"): return url.replace("localhost", "127.0.0.1") return url def create_http_session(timeout: Optional[aiohttp.ClientTimeout] = None) -> aiohttp.ClientSession: """ Create a configured aiohttp ClientSession for backend API requests. Args: timeout: Optional timeout configuration. Defaults to 30 seconds total timeout. Returns: Configured aiohttp.ClientSession """ if timeout is None: timeout = aiohttp.ClientTimeout(total=30, connect=10) connector = aiohttp.TCPConnector( ssl=False, limit=100, limit_per_host=30, force_close=True, enable_cleanup_closed=True ) ssl_context = ssl.create_default_context() ssl_context.check_hostname = False ssl_context.verify_mode = ssl.CERT_NONE return aiohttp.ClientSession( connector=connector, timeout=timeout, headers={ "Content-Type": "application/json", "Accept": "application/json" } )
